    Efficacy of biocide-based sanitizer in daily use during the COVID–19 pandemic

    BackgroundThe objective of this study was to evaluate the effectiveness of a biocide-based disinfectant against pathogenic flora on the skin of the hands.Material and methodsThis is a prospective study of 30 participants from the general population. The questionnaire, interview data and results of two swab analysis were collected. All the data were statistically analysed.ResultsThe results showed that after the hand disinfection with the biocide based disinfectant, number of colonies on the participants’ skin decreased or completely disappeared, and a significant correlation was found between the number of colonies before and after disinfection. In case of Coagulase – negative staphylococcus the number of Colony – forming unit (CFU) significantly decreased [p<0,001]. Also Bacillus ssp. and Acinetobacter spp. were also found in 17.6 % (n=3) of the cases after the disinfection however the number of the colonies was significantly decreased [p=0,001; p=0,008].ConclusionsOur study demonstrates that a biocide-based disinfectant has high effectiveness against Gram positive, Gram negative, as well as fungal pathogens
